How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Amazon?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Amazon Studio Apartments | $1,484 | $750 | $1,839 |
| Amazon 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,872 | $595 | $3,800 |
| Amazon 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,762 | $699 | $3,176 |
| Amazon 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,489 | $700 | $3,200 |
| Amazon 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,188 | $500 | $3,895 |
| Amazon 5 Bedroom Apartments | $1,115 | $500 | $3,800 |
